A suspenseful story!
Hunting the Amish Witness by Dana R. Lynn is a fast-paced, suspenseful story. I liked Miriam and Caleb. I was rooting for these resilient, well-crafted characters to survive. I liked seeing the characters grow in character and faith. There was danger, tension, and action which kept things lively. There is a touch of romance as well. There was a thread of faith stitched through the story. I was very pleased that the author included an epilogue. Hunting the Amish Witness is the twentieth book in the Amish Country Justice series. Each book in the series can be read on its own. Hunting the Amish Witness is a page turner with a car wreck, disremembered memories, a corrupt killer, a blast from the past, a beloved baby, and a second chance romance.

High Octane
This is book 20 in the Amish Country Justice but each can be read as a stand-alone. Although if you have read previous books you will get glimpses of some characters. I have not read them all but every one that I have read has kept my attention throughout. If you are looking for a quick read that keeps you turning pages quickly to see the outcome then look no further. I was cheering for Miriam and the safety of her and baby Ella Mae. She was brave and how she changed into the woman she is was profound. It is high octane from beginning to end and you will not want to put it down. Pick up a copy and settle in for an entertaining, well written story with characters you will love. I received a complimentary copy from the author. The honest review and opinions are my own and were not required.
